Question You are playing six handed with blinds at $1/$2 effective $50 stacks. It’s folded around to the decent player in the cut-off, who raises to $8. Folded to you in the bb with 55, and you call. The flop comes 5♣ 7♣ A♦. What should you do?
January 24, 2012 - QOTD
Correct Answer: Bet out
You want to win your opponent’s stack, so bet now and start building the pot. If you check-raise you may get your opponent to call with a decent ace, but he may just fold everything else. If you bet out now your opponent will call with all aces and/or even bluff your donk bet. So bet out now.
